“大部分码农无法成为架构师的一个原因。一直停留在业务层面,把砖砌的再好,终究只是砌砖师傅。”“对于绝大多数编程从业开发者而言都面临一个普遍的问题:广度与深度难以兼顾。”“底层知识学扎实了,上层的东西像风筝一般千变万化,而你是在底下扯线的那个人,顺着线往下拉,便能轻松看清楚这个风筝长什么样。”与诸君共勉~Android基础Android 四大组件Service1、Service 的生命周期2、Ser
# Android Studio合并分支教程
作为一名经验丰富的开发者,我将为你详细介绍如何在Android Studio中合并分支。本教程将按照以下步骤进行,以确保你能够顺利完成合并操作。
## 步骤概览
下面是整个合并分支的流程概览,我们将逐步展开每个步骤的具体操作。
| 步骤 | 操作 |
| --- | --- |
| 1. 创建并切换到目标分支 | `git checkout -
原创
2023-08-03 04:14:56
203阅读
# Android Studio合并分支的流程
下面是Android Studio合并分支的步骤表格:
| 步骤 | 操作 |
| ---- | ---- |
| 1. | 创建并切换到目标分支 |
| 2. | 合并源分支到目标分支 |
| 3. | 解决冲突(如果有) |
| 4. | 提交合并结果 |
## 介绍
在软件开发中,使用版本控制系
原创
2023-08-01 12:03:21
370阅读
项目要求:现有两个完整项目A、B,需要合并成一个项目C。经过查找资料后决定使用,将A、B打成library,创建一个项目C,以类库的形式调用这两个项目。将项目转成library需要注意事项: 一、转换方法。 1、使用Android Studio将项目以model形式导入。 2、选择项目中的app目录。 3、注意这里会出现一个警告,是由于model项目的名字和主项目中的app目录冲突,修改要
转载
2017-03-14 16:17:49
220阅读
# Android Studio中Git分支合并教程
在现代软件开发中,使用版本控制系统(VCS)如Git是必不可少的。Git允许开发者在项目中创建和管理分支,便于多人协作以及功能的独立开发。本文将为大家介绍如何在Android Studio中进行Git分支合并,并提供相关代码示例以及类图。
## 什么是Git分支?
Git分支是Git版本控制中的一个重要概念。简单来说,分支是项目开发中用来
原创
2024-09-14 06:36:23
61阅读
一、SVN架构逻辑
先在trunk项目的主干代码版本上,通过SVN右键建立分支到branches,完成新建分支,这些分支都是主干代码的副本。
1、主干与分支上,均可以进行commit、update等操作,但在不发生merge的情况下,是各自独立、互不干扰的;
2、分支版本为减少偏离主线,不修改的代码部分应与主干版本保持一致,所以应发生代码编写前进行主干到分支的merge;
3、主干代
转载
2024-10-28 20:13:22
49阅读
# Android Studio Git分支与分支合并教程
## 整体流程
在Android Studio中操作Git分支与分支合并的过程可以概括为以下步骤:
| 步骤 | 操作 |
|------|------|
| 1 | 新建分支 |
| 2 | 切换分支 |
| 3 | 开发新功能 |
| 4 | 合并分支 |
## 每一步操作
### 1. 新建分支
首先,你需要在Andro
原创
2024-05-14 04:30:30
131阅读
# 项目方案:使用 Android Studio 合并分支
## 引言
在开发 Android 应用程序时,通常需要使用版本控制系统来管理代码。版本控制系统可以帮助我们跟踪代码的修改、协作开发以及管理不同分支。Android Studio 提供了集成的版本控制功能,其中包括合并分支的功能。
本文将介绍如何使用 Android Studio 合并分支,同时提供代码示例和类图。
## 准备工作
原创
2023-10-13 06:43:29
285阅读
# Android Studio Git 合并分支的综合指南
在现代软件开发中,版本控制是一个不可或缺的工具,而 Git 是目前最流行的版本控制系统之一。本文将介绍如何在 Android Studio 中使用 Git 来合并分支,我们将涵盖相关理论背景、凑合代码示例,以及状态和序列图来帮助更好地理解合并分支的过程。
## Git 和分支
分支是在 Git 中的一种重要概念,它允许开发者在不同
原创
2024-08-28 04:19:57
72阅读
# Android Studio中的分支合并
在软件开发中,版本控制是非常重要的一个环节,它可以帮助开发团队管理代码的变更历史,协同合作,并且保证代码的稳定性和可追溯性。而分支合并则是版本控制中的一个重要操作,它可以将不同分支上的代码变更合并到一起,确保代码的完整性和一致性。
在Android Studio中,我们可以通过Git来管理代码版本,并进行分支合并操作。下面将介绍Android St
原创
2024-04-19 04:00:52
55阅读
# Android Studio Git合并分支教程
## 1. 流程概述
在使用Git进行代码版本管理时,合并分支是非常常见的操作。Android Studio提供了便捷的工具和命令行来完成这个任务。下面是合并分支的整个流程:
| 步骤 | 描述 |
| --- | --- |
| 1 | 更新远程主分支 |
| 2 | 创建并切换到新的本地分支 |
| 3 | 在新的本地分支上进行开发
原创
2023-09-18 04:32:40
528阅读
背景在输出Android模块时,有时会因为个别原因(比如来自业务的不可抗力),要求将模块打包成一个文件提供给接入方。这就意味着在输出模块由多个子模块组成的情况下,我们需要把多个AAR(或JAR)合并成一个大AAR输出,这个合并过程涉及到了很多有用的知识和难点,这篇文章就详细解析下其中的内容。首先来直观认识下AARAAR文件是一种Android归档包(类比Jar:Java Archive),这种归档
转载
2024-03-05 21:42:24
80阅读
信息整理分析完成后,我们就可以根据得到的结果基本推导出项目的信息架构。如果是开放式卡片分类分组名未确定的情况下,我们可以通过卡片-分组名矩阵归类法找出最适合的分组名,可以通过卡片间相似度分析矩阵得出卡片相互之间的或紧密或疏离的关系。通过聚类群簇分析可以对照分组名找出适合的分组数量,因为卡片之间关系越疏离,则从右侧分叉越早,卡片之间关系越紧密,则从右侧分叉越晚,最紧密的几张卡片之间甚至没有分叉。从这
转载
2021-05-29 01:56:16
126阅读
# Android Studio 分支代码合并教程
## 一、整体流程
以下是合并代码的整体流程:
```mermaid
pie
title 合并代码流程
"创建分支" : 25%
"修改代码" : 25%
"提交更改" : 25%
"合并分支" : 25%
```
## 二、具体步骤
| 步骤 | 操作 |
| ---- | ---- |
| 1
原创
2024-04-05 06:32:50
165阅读
# Android Studio开发分支合并到主分支
在软件开发过程中,团队通常会使用分支来并行开发不同的功能或修复bug。当一个功能或修复被认为稳定并且准备投入生产时,需要将其合并到主分支。在本文中,我们将介绍如何将Android Studio开发分支合并到主分支,并提供示例代码来帮助理解。
## 什么是分支和主分支
在版本控制系统(VCS)中,分支是一个独立的代码线,用于开发新功能或修复
原创
2024-01-20 03:48:18
128阅读
顾名思义,组件化能够让开发者只需专注自己开发的组件,独立运行自己的模块,节省编译时间,减少因别人的问题导致工作被打断的可能。组件化的实现围绕下面几个点 1、子模块单独编译 2、sdk和第三方库的版本一致性 3、资源重复定义 4、模块之间页面跳转 5、模块之间数据传递 6、模块初始化处理1、子模块如何单独编译 我们希望在开发模式下,能够单独调试自己的模块,编译成独立的apk。而在主程序发布时,成为一
转载
2024-09-21 14:11:16
80阅读
# Android Studio中使用SVN进行分支合并的指南
在软件开发中,版本控制是至关重要的,特别是在团队协作中。SVN(Subversion)作为一种常见的版本控制系统,为开发者提供了强大的分支管理功能。本文将讲解如何在Android Studio中使用SVN进行分支合并,并提供具体的代码示例和图示。
## 什么是分支?
分支是版本控制的一种重要功能,允许开发者在主线代码的基础上进行
## Android Studio 不同分支合并教程
### 一、整体流程
在Android Studio中实现不同分支的合并主要分为以下几个步骤: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 在本地创建并切换到新的分支 |
| 2 | 在新分支上进行开发或修改 |
| 3 | 提交修改到新分支 |
| 4 | 切换回主分支 |
| 5 | 合并新分支到主分支 |
|
原创
2024-02-25 07:14:09
174阅读
# Android Studio 合并分支到主干
作为一名经验丰富的开发者,我将会教给你如何在Android Studio中实现将分支合并到主干的步骤。下面是整个流程的详细步骤,以及每一步需要做的事情和对应的代码。
## 流程图
```mermaid
flowchart TD
A[创建分支] --> B[切换到分支]
B --> C[进行开发]
C --> D[提交分支]
D
原创
2023-09-29 16:07:40
167阅读
一、Git和GitHub简述1.Git分布式版本控制系统,最先使用于Linux社区,是一个开源免费的版本控制系统,功能类似于SVN和CVS。Git与其他版本管理工具最大的区别点和优点就是分布式;Git是采用分布式版本库机制,不需要每次都将文件推送到版本控制服务器,每个开发人员都可以从服务器中克隆一份完整的版本库到本地,不用完全依赖于版本控制服务器。【优点:1.代码的发布和合并更加便捷;2.可以离线
转载
2023-12-19 23:11:55
120阅读